The MMORPG Rift has been running since 2011 and was once intended as an alternative to WoW. Meanwhile, the game belongs to the German company Gamigo, which has just buried a series of MMORPGs. The fans of Rift fear: “We are the next.” However, a community manager reassures the fans.

What is going on with Rift? The MMORPG Rift was long the flagship of the MMO company Trion Worlds. “RIFT: Planes of Telara” launched in 2011 as a competitor to the popular WoW and was quite a hit at release. The game brought several features that are highly valued by MMORPG fans:

  • It has a clever class system
  • offers a clever “group” event with the Rifts
  • had a fair “Free2Play” payment model for years, starting in 2013
  • brought more cool features in housing and pets

Rift has always been considered a solid, “good” MMORPG, missing only that “certain something” to become a major hit. It was often criticized for being “too close to WoW” and not daring enough to be unique. However, Rift had many fans, especially at the beginning, and was a significant success for Trion Worlds during the great MMORPG wave.

But Rift could not maintain its success in the long term, and in recent years, the game has declined. The content became weaker, the payment model more stingy and the fans angrier.

Meanwhile, Rift is on our list of the “WoW killers that have been killed by WoW.” Even though it is not dead yet, the glory days of Rift are clearly over.

German company takes over Rift, treats it poorly

When did it start to decline? It wasn’t necessarily due to Rift, but Trion Worlds had a series of failures with new games and had to give up in 2018: The company was sold.

The games of Trion Worlds were ultimately taken over by the German company Gamigo. Their business policy consists of acquiring existing MMORPGs, saving costs through synergy effects and continuing to operate the games and make money with them.

That’s why Rift fans are worried: Even at the takeover of Trion Worlds, things did not look good for Rift. It was treated rather poorly and hardly mentioned anymore. Gamigo’s focus at that time was on the newer MMORPG ArcheAge and Trove. The focus is still on these two games today.

Moreover, Gamigo was recently on a “we are killing MMORPGs” trip. At the end of February, they killed three games they had previously bought, including Eden Eternal, Twin Saga, and the shooter Defiance. The latter also came from Trion Worlds and was only slightly better off in terms of profits than Rift.

When they shut down these MMOs, Gamigo encouraged their players to check out the other MMORPGs of the company, but only mentioned Trove and ArcheAge as alternatives. There was no word about Rift.

Additionally, the MMORPG site MassivelyOP reported new news: a source had tipped them off that several “Gamigo developers” in the USA had been laid off. Among them were two long-time and well-known Rift developers, Kerilar and Acalos.

WoW Guide: How to unlock the “Bound Shadehound” mount

WoW has secretly added a new mount. MeinMMO reveals in the guide how to quickly unlock the “Bound Shadehound”.

Not all content from Patch 9.0.5 is listed in the patch notes. A more or less “secret” mount has snuck into World of Warcraft: Shadowlands. This is a Bound Shadehound. A mount that you often see among the Maw’s servants. You can’t just buy the mount, as it’s hidden behind a little puzzle. We will show you step by step how to unlock this mount and then ride it in the Maw!

The images shown in this article are from wowhead.

1. Buy the Stygian Tensor

First, you need to buy the Stygian Tensor from Ve’nari in Ve’naris Refuge. It costs a staggering 1,500 Stygia and will only be offered to you if you have already reached maximum reputation with her. If not, you need to gather more reputation by completing daily and weekly quests or defeating rare enemies in the Maw.

Anyone who has been gathering reputation since the launch of Shadowlands should have long since reached the maximum with her.

With the Stygian Tensor, you can locate small green clouds everywhere in the Maw. These are usually in hard-to-reach places (like on towers, behind strong enemies, or at the end of caves).

WoW Shadehound Guide 1
You need to find these green clouds.

Use the Tensor to extract Stygia Shards and Stygian Dust from the clouds. Collect at least 200 shards and dust each.

The small clouds will also be displayed on the minimap as soon as you are nearby – if you are carrying the Stygian Tensor.

2. Off to the Torghast Fortress

Now you need to travel to the Torghast Fortress and go to the coordinates 23 / 68. There you can see a hook that you can select to pull yourself up onto a platform gradually until you reach coordinates 24 / 76. This is a tower with a green cloud. Use the Stygian Tensor here to switch to another phase.

A box with 6 runes will now appear, floating above the box. By clicking on the runes, you can swap the positions of any two runes.

Focus on the tips of the tower surrounding you. At the tips, you will see the identical runes that are also floating above the box.

The correct order of the runes on the box.

You need to ensure that the runes above the box are in the same order as the runes at the tips. The first rune corresponds to the tip left of the hook point, then proceed clockwise.

But be careful! You should not simply click wildly. If you take too many steps or take too long, this part of the puzzle will be locked for two hours. Then you will have to return later and try again.

Once you have solved the puzzle, you can open the box and receive a Crumbling Stela.

3. Ve’nari and the Codex

Once you have the Crumbling Stela in your inventory, you can return to Ve’nari. She now has a new item available, a not yet complete Rune Codex. It costs a whopping 2,000 Stygia and sends you on the next mission.

You need to complete the Codex by finding the missing pages. These can be found at the following coordinates:

  • Page 1 can be found in a cave of the Beast Maze. The entrance to the cave is at coordinates 49 / 85.
  • Page 2 can be found in the Torghast Fortress, on the platform with the rare enemy Tanassos. The page is located at coordinates 27 / 72.
  • The last page can be found in the Tremaculum on one of the towers where Anduin was held at the beginning of Shadowlands. The exact coordinates are 27 / 13.
The pages glow and sparkle slightly, making them easy to spot.

Once you have collected all the pages, you can transform the Codex into its complete version. The Codex basically tells you how to solve the rest of the puzzle.

4. Crafting the Metals

For this step, you need to have farmed a significant amount first. You will need:

  • 200x Stygian Dust
  • 200x Stygia Shards
  • 1x Soul Smith’s Tools

You obtain dust and shards from the aforementioned green clouds, while the Soul Smith’s Tools can be obtained from Soul Smith Rhovus, a rare mob at coordinates 36 / 42.

Once you have collected the items, head to the coordinates 23 / 68, where you can select a hook point again. Work your way up the fortress with multiple hooks until you arrive at the Soul Steel Anvil at coordinates 20 / 67.

Process the dust and shards into 20 Stygian Bars and then the bars with the tools into “Armored Shell”.

WoW Shadehound Guide 4
At the anvil, you process the items.

5. Catch the Stray Soul

This step is quite simple. Go to the Soul River Gorgoa and look for a stray soul. This is the soul of a wolf that wanders south from the north through the river. After a while, it reappears in the north and repeats its route. You just need to click the soul and you will receive a Wolf Soul.

WoW Shadehound Guide 5
This Wolf Soul later serves as your mount.

6. Bind the Soul

The last step is also simple. Travel to the coordinates 45 / 48 and click the altar. This creates a “Wild Shadehound”.

This is a quest starter that provides you with the final step of this puzzle. Once you use the item, you will mount the wild shadehound that will panic and run in all directions. You now need to click the runes in the correct order to successfully bind the mount to yourself.

The correct order of the runes can be found on the stela that you received in step 2 of this puzzle.

Is the mount worth it? Especially for players who want to ride in the Maw without relying on luck or wanting to play through the winding corridors of Torghast. The “Bound Shadehound” is a good alternative to the other two mounts and can be earned relatively quickly with comparatively little effort.

Is the mount needed in the long term? No. Starting with Patch 9.1 Chains of Domination, players will have the opportunity to unlock all mounts for the Maw. However, this patch is still at least a few months away, so you will have to wait a long time for the unlocking of this ability. If you don’t want to travel permanently on foot through the Maw until then, you should at least consider acquiring the Shadehound.

Valheim: Viking farms endless resources – method is creative, but also brutal

A player has found a way to exploit the game mechanics in Valheim for endless resources. To do this, he builds a kind of very grotesque killing machine from simple means that automatically eliminates enemies and provides him with loot.

What kind of device is this? Reddit user Leathermattress calls his creation the “Greydwarf Toaster 5000”. It consists basically of a large hole, a fence, and many campfires. Crafting this “toaster” is relatively easy:

  • find a spawner – these are objects in the world where enemies continuously appear
  • dig a pit around the spawner with the pickaxe without destroying it. Here you can learn how to get your first pickaxe in Valheim
  • build campfires around the pillar on which the spawner should now stand
  • put up fences (Skigard) so that the fires are enclosed
  • alternatively, build palisades or stakes around the pit if you are worried the fence won’t hold

This construct allows you to simply wait until the enemies die and then collect their loot. You don’t have to fight. You can see what it looks like in the embedded reddit post here:

The Greydwarf toaster 5000. from r/valheim

How does it work? In Valheim, there are so-called “spawners” around which enemies reappear regularly until they are destroyed. The enemies always spawn close to the spawner and only begin moving shortly after.

However, since a hole has been dug around the spawner in this case, the enemies fall directly into the pit. There, burning fires surrounded by a fence wait. The fire continuously deals damage to them and slowly kills them, while the fence prevents them from escaping.

All enemies in Valheim leave loot behind, and when they die through this “toaster”, you can collect everything they leave behind. This can be quite rewarding.

Farm endless resources without fighting

What resources can I farm? Depending on which area you are in and which spawners you find, you can get different resources. The most commonly found spawners are:

  • Greydwarf nests for various greydwarfs – a source primarily for resin, wood, and greydwarf eyes for portals
  • Bone piles for skeletons – providing you with bone fragments
  • Corpse piles for draugrs – good for entrails

Especially the corpse piles are particularly useful since you need entrails for sausages. Sausages are strong food that can help you through midgame and until about the fourth boss, as they are easy to make. In our guide, you will find the best food in Valheim and how to craft it.

Destiny 2 enters uncharted territory … reluctantly

This is what it’s about: According to the “master plan” of Activision, Destiny 2 should actually only last two years. But the plan is already very old.

But it is quite possible that in 2018 they still believed the lifespan of Destiny 2 would be about 3 years, like Destiny 1. This means: Destiny 2 actually had to end in September 2020, and players would then have moved on to Destiny 3. After separating from Activision, Bungie decided to extend Destiny 2 and at least plan for 6 years.

The underlying technology and design do not seem to be aimed at a “6 years” game but only for a “3 years” game. Therefore, Bungie must now find ways to remove “content” from the game when new content comes in.

This is generally unusual and against the spirit of an “MMO”: games are supposed to grow continuously; shrinking has never been mentioned.

Thus, Destiny 2 is entering uncharted territory and receiving a lot of criticism for this decision. Bungie has since distanced itself from “sunsetting”, a similar idea, but it seems they want to hold on to the controversial content vault.

All EU servers of Rust are burning down and hardly any player finds it bad

In a fire at a server farm in France, all EU servers of the survival game Rust have burned down. Players have therefore lost all progress they had made since the last reset. However, most of them are taking it in stride – especially veterans just shrug it off a bit.

What happened? On March 10th, there was a fire in a data center in Strasbourg, France, where Rust lost the server data of all 25 EU servers. The data center belongs to the provider OVH, where different customers had their servers set up.

What exactly was lost? All server-side data is lost, as there is no backup for it. This includes:

  • Map data, meaning what loot is in which crates
  • Buildings of players that they built on the map and stored equipment
  • Inventory and equipment of players on the servers

In short: everything that players have achieved in Rust is now lost and seems irretrievable. This sounds like terrible news that no MMO player ever wants to hear. However, the Rust community isn’t really bothered by it.

rust neighbors pvp-server
Whoever built a nice base has lost it due to the fire.

Servers are literally smoking – players take it in stride

That’s why hardly anyone is bothered: Rust carries out a so-called “force wipe” from the developers each month, where all servers are reset – both official and the private servers that you can rent yourself.

This reduces server load and there is always the opportunity to restart. Especially veterans are already used to this and therefore see little problem in it happening outside of the rules. The user Yellow_Tissue on reddit writes, for example:

I’m pretty sure that the force wipe takes place once a month, but the vast majority of players play on servers with weekly resets. So it’s not really that bad and probably the reason why no one cared about a backup.

Most comments go in this direction. The last wipe took place on March 5, so not even a week of progress was lost. Also, all cosmetics should still be intact after the fire, as users on reddit explain. These are linked to the Steam inventory, not to the server data, and the inventory is unaffected.

The best revolver from earlier is back in Destiny 2 – How strong is it now?

Destiny 2 has brought back the hand cannon the Palindrome. Is the classic still as strong as in Destiny 1 and where can you find the master version? We also take a look at the perks so you can specifically farm for a God Roll.

This weapon is about: The Palindrome is a 140 hand cannon that now deals Void damage. Since Season 13, you can obtain the classic in Destiny 2, but not every week.

In Destiny 1, the question “Is the Palindrome or the Eyasluna stronger?” especially plagued the crucible lovers and became a matter of faith. While the numbers mostly favored the Palindrome, the colorful toy-like design turned many against it.

The good news:

  • You can now completely rid the Palindrome of its hated look with shaders and even make it look really cool.
  • The Palindrome is currently the best legendary 140.
The Palindrome in Destiny 2 (with shader)

The bad news: the weapon is significantly harder to obtain this time than in Destiny 1. Especially rare and coveted should be the master version, for which you will have to really struggle.

[toc]

How to get the Palindrome in Season 13 of Destiny 2

Play this activity: In the Season of the Chosen, Bungie has made the Nightfall: The Ordeal more attractive. Here and only here can you randomly obtain the Palindrome after completion.

It is important to note that the Palindrome can only be obtained every 3 weeks. Each week, the weapon reward rotates. The Palindrome shares the loot pool with the auto rifle Shadow Price and the SMG The Swarm – both of which are also known from Destiny 1.

In the Destiny week from March 9 to March 16, the Palindrome is in rotation – if you want one, you should farm now. Your next chance will be from March 30.

Which trial is the right one? As mentioned, the weapon is not a guaranteed drop. However, you can increase your chances by mastering harder levels of the ordeal. But even at the highest level, the drop is not guaranteed.

  • Master: Power level 1,230 and 1 modifier – with automatic matchmaking (Weapon chance: “rare”)
  • Hero: Power level 1,270 and 4 modifiers – with automatic matchmaking (Weapon chance: “unusual”)
  • Legend: Power level 1,300 and 6 modifiers – without automatic matchmaking (Weapon chance: “normal”)
  • Grandmaster: Power level 1,330 and 8 modifiers – without automatic matchmaking (Weapon chance: “normal”)

Even though Legend and Grandmaster both display the same drop chance in-game, guardians swear that Grandmaster drops the reward significantly more often. It is thus true: the harder the ordeal, the more frequently you will receive the weapon.

  • Solo guardians should start in Hero and prepare for the champions with appropriate mods.
  • In a full fireteam, if the power is right, you should tackle the Grandmaster version. Here, however, the entire loadout must be coordinated.
  • Better equip “Tactician’s Wealth” (3) in your ghost’s activity slot. Whether that really helps is debated – but what do you have to lose?
The Swarm, the Palindrome, and Shadow Price await in the ordeal

How to obtain the master version in the ordeal

From Palindrome, The Swarm, and Shadow Price, you can obtain a so-called master version. For this, you must complete the ordeal at a Grandmaster level. The only other master weapons can be earned in the Trials of Osiris.

These are the specifics:

  • As a fully leveled masterpiece, the weapon receives +10 to one stat (like every weapon) and +3 to the other stats.
  • An exclusive shader, which only the master version possesses.
  • Access to special master mods like “Masterwork Range” (+10 range) or “Master Icarus” (+5 range and better accuracy in the air) – the mods can be obtained from the ordeal and Osiris.

When does it start? Grandmaster is not live yet, so the prestigious master version cannot be played yet. In-game, it states that the Grandmaster difficulty will start on March 16. A power level of 1,350 is indicated.

Is Palindrome in Destiny 2 as good as we remember it?

To put it simply: In the current sandbox of Season 13, Palindrome is not 100% meta. In PvE, hand cannons serve well as primary weapons, but SMGs are somewhat better. In PvP, the 120 hand cannons are currently reigning, as they are deadly at much longer ranges.

Nevertheless, Palindrome is likely the strongest 140 in the game. If a buff for this archetype comes – or a nerf for the other guns – it could quickly become top-tier. This is due to its outstanding base stats.

Additionally, the perk pool of Palindrome is very manageable. Almost every drop is usable, and the chances of a God Roll are not bad.

This is worth it in PvE: In Season 13, you can disrupt champions with hand cannons. As has been the case for a long time, you want to deal more damage with the revolvers and reload as infrequently or briefly as possible. Therefore, keep an eye out for these perks:

  • Barrel: Smallbore (+7 stability and range)
  • Magazine: Extended Mag (increases magazine size significantly) or Fluted Barrel (+5 stability and +15 reload speed)
  • Slot 1: Outlaw (after a precision kill, reload speed is increased) or Kill Clip (after kills, range, mobility, and handling increase)
  • Slot 2: Rampage (increases damage up to level 3 after a kill) or One For All (increases damage when hitting 3 enemies for 10 seconds)

How does the Palindrome perform in PvP?

In the crucible, the 120 hand cannons currently dominate – just like the rare and coveted The Last Dollar. They have a slightly slower TTK (1.0 seconds) than the 140s (0.87 seconds) but more range and the potential to kill with 2 shots (TTK of 0.5 seconds).

The Palindrome comes very close to the champions in terms of performance, as is possible for a legendary weapon. The stats in the important categories are all above average:

The stats of the Palindrome without perks – Source: Light.gg

Range and stability are impressive from the start. The hidden values of aim assist (79) and recoil control (98) are excellent.

Seek these rolls:

  • Barrel: Smallbore (+7 stability and range)
  • Magazine: Ricochet Rounds (+5 range and stability) or High-Caliber Rounds (+5 range and more flinch per shot)
  • Slot 1: Accelerated Battery (the weapon draws faster, swaps faster, and aims faster) or Kill Clip (after kills, range, mobility, and handling increase)
  • Slot 2: Snapshot Sights (more range and zoom) – Note that with the higher zoom factor, you need to aim more precisely.

You have a revolver that is drawn very quickly and has probably the best mix of range and stability. As a masterwork, you can’t go wrong with either of the two stats, and mods such as “Targeting Adjuster” or “Icarus” are recommended.

Conclusion: In Destiny 2, the Palindrome has lost some of its shine. However, thanks to shaders, it no longer looks so silly – which is very important for many guardians. Should a buff for 140s happen, then you will be well-prepared with this revolver, and you should definitely farm a few rolls.

Of the 3 Nightfall weapons, the Palindrome is probably the most interesting. Just because guardians are simply hand cannon fanatics. Once the master version is available, the weapon will be even better and significantly more coveted.

Nvidia wanted to stop mining on RTX 3060, but hackers have now cracked the blockade

Nvidia wanted to make the RTX 3060 uninteresting for miners. For this, they relied on a hardware and software solution. However, hackers managed to bypass these measures.

Here’s the deal: The RTX 3000 graphics cards (GPU) are currently in high demand, and both miners and gamers are fighting for the few graphics cards available.

Nvidia made the RTX 3060 uninteresting for miners by utilizing a combination of software and hardware solutions.

However, in China, it seems they have managed to bypass these restrictions and utilize the full efficiency of the card.

Nvidia originally wanted to make mining uninteresting with the RTX 3060

This was Nvidia’s idea: Nvidia configures the software for the graphics cards so that the software can recognize certain mining algorithms.

The software must be installed by anyone who wants to use the graphics card. Once this software detects that someone wants to mine cryptocurrencies, the hash rate is halved. And this hash rate is crucial for mining.

However, it’s not just about the software, as the software also works together with the BIOS of the graphics card:

https://twitter.com/bdelrizzo/status/1362619264423747590

This way, Nvidia aimed to make the smallest RTX 3000 card uninteresting for miners.

What does the BIOS do? The BIOS is a part of the software and contains all the essential core functions. Among other things, it ensures that your graphics card starts and is checked for correctness.

A BIOS can also be found on your motherboard, which starts the computer and checks if all components are functioning correctly.

In the same breath, Nvidia also presented the CMP (Cryptocurrency Mining Processor), a graphics processor aimed at professional miners. Instead of buying the RTX 3060 for mining, they should consider buying the new series instead.

Changes in cryptocurrency play a role for graphics cards

What do miners do at all? Miners use graphics cards to mine digital currenc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um. With their hardware, they solve complex cryptographic puzzles, for which they are then rewarded with currency. Currently, the rule is: those who contribute the most power to the solution receive the reward at the end (Proof of Work).

What will happen in the future? In the long term, it looks like graphics cards will no longer play such a significant role in mining starting from 2022.

  • The easiest cryptocurrency that can be mined with graphics cards is Ethereum.
  • However, with the upgrade to Ethereum 2.0, the performance of the graphics card will likely no longer matter. Here, a new concept is being introduced, which is expected to replace the old reward system in the long run.

This should (hopefully) positively impact the graphics card market starting in 2022. Prices for graphics cards may then drop a bit.
